How to Say ‘A small homemade tiramisu’ in German
Ein kleines hausgemachtes Tiramisu
ine KLINE-ess HOWSS-guh-makh-tess tee-rah-mee-SOO
[ine KLINE-ess HOWSS-guh-makh-tess tee-rah-mee-SOO]
💬 Usage Tip: In [ein kleines hausgemachtes Tiramisu], both describing words change shape to match [Tiramisu]. You'll see the same pattern in [ein kleines kaltes Wasser].
